Black Soldiers in Blue

Black Soldiers in Blue
Inspired 'troop history' and informed by the latest research in African American, military, 'troop history' and social history, the fourteen original essays in this book tell the stories of the African American soldiers who fought for the Union cause.An introductory essay surveys the history of the U.S. Colored Troops (USCT) from emancipation to the end of the Civil War. Seven essays focus on the role of the USCT in combat, chronicling the contributions of African Americans who fought at Port Hudson, Milliken`s Bend, Olustee, Fort Pillow, Petersburg, Saltville, 'troop history' and Nashville. Other essays explore the recruitment of black troops in the Mississippi Valley; the U.S. Colored Cavalry; the military leadership of Colonels Thomas Higginson, James Montgomery, 'troop history' and Robert Shaw; African American chaplain Henry McNeal Turner; the black troops who occupied postwar Charleston; 'troop history' and the experiences of USCT veterans in postwar North Carolina. Collectively, these essays probe the broad military, political, 'troop history' and social significance of black soldiers` armed service, enriching our understanding of the Civil War 'troop history' and African American life during 'troop history' and after the conflict.The contributors are Anne J. The Sergeant in the Snow

The Sergeant in the Snow
Mario Rigoni Stern was barely twenty-one -- 'troop history' and already a battle veteran -- at the time of the hallucinating World War II disaster searchingly described in this book. In July 1942, the Italian forces in Russia totaled 230,000 men. They included three divisions of Alpini troops, specially trained for winter warfare; the author of this book belonged to one of these, the Tridentina. In December, the troops began retreating, entirely on foot, with no supplies, at a temperature of 30-40 degrees below zero. Many of the troops, overcome by exhaustion, broke away from the column, others were cut off 'troop history' and captured by the Russians, 'troop history' and others got lost in the steppes. In the end, about 90,000 were missing or dead; about 45,000 frostbitten 'troop history' and wounded. This narrative, together with his novel The Story of Tonle 'troop history' and several other works, paints a broad fresco of Italy's history in this century, chronicling social 'troop history' and political change so radical 'troop history' and profound that it has touched even those in such secluded provincial communities as those Rigoni Stern has so masterfully described.
